7.14 Extraction Tank 7.14
The condensate recovered from the drying is fed to the extraction tank.
In the same way, the condensate runs from the 1
st
fraction of the distillation into the extraction tank.
The condensate from the 1
st
fraction distillation mainly contains water and low-boiling solvent.
In the extraction tank, the water and other low-boiling solvents are separated from the cleaning
solvent.
The heavy water collects at the bottom. In the lower area, there is a water-sensitive level sensor,
which controls the draining of the process water.
Higher up, the solvent is routinely suctioned off and then used for the precleaning bath or
suctioned off to the distillation. There is always a residual amount of solvent and water that
remains in the extraction tank. This is why you must carry out maintenance on the tank routinely.
There is a fixed program available for this.
